How do you clean up old branches automatically?

Short answer: Old branches can clutter your repo. You can clean them locally and remotely. Commands: To delete merged branches locally: git branch --merged main | grep -v "main" | xargs git branch -d To prune deleted remote branches: git fetch --prune Example: After several months, your repo has 50 old feature branches. You can prune them automatically in CI or periodically with these commands.
